window.pipedriveLeadboosterConfig = { base: 'leadbooster-chat.pipedrive.com', companyId: 11580370, playbookUuid: '22236db1-6d50-40c4-b48f-8b11262155be', versjon: 2, } ;(function () { var w = vindu if (w.LeadBooster) { console.warn('LeadBooster finnes allerede') } else { w.LeadBooster = { q: [], on: function (n, h) { this.q.push({ t: 'o', n: n, h: h }) }, trigger: function (n) { this.q.push({ t: 't', n: n }) }, } } })() Roundrobin-planlegging - The Codest
Pil tilbake GÅ TILBAKE

Round Robin-planlegging

Round Robin Scheduling er en dataalgoritme som brukes i operativsystemer og nettverkssystemer for å planlegge og allokere ressurser på en rettferdig og effektiv måte. Det er en preemptiv planleggingsalgoritme som ofte brukes i multitasking- og tidsdelingssystemer. Algoritmen fungerer ved at hver prosess i en kø tildeles et fast tidsintervall eller kvantum, og deretter kjøres hver prosess i en sirkulær rekkefølge.

Round Robin Scheduling sørger for at hver prosess får like mye CPU-tid, og forhindrer dermed at én prosess monopoliserer systemressursene. Dette gjør den til en rettferdig planleggingsalgoritme, spesielt i situasjoner der flere prosesser konkurrerer om ressursene. Algoritmen er også effektiv, ettersom den gir rask responstid for hver prosess og sørger for at systemet forblir responsivt selv under tung belastning.

Round Robin Scheduling-algoritmen er mye brukt i sanntidssystemer, der det er viktig å garantere et visst ytelsesnivå. Den brukes også i nettverkssystemer, der den brukes til å tildele båndbredde og ressurser til ulike brukere og applikasjoner. I tillegg brukes den i nettskybaserte databehandlingsmiljøer, der den brukes til å tildele ressurser til ulike virtuelle maskiner.

Round Robin Scheduling har imidlertid visse begrensninger. Det faste tidsintervallet kan være for kort for enkelte prosesser, noe som fører til ineffektiv ressursbruk. I tillegg kan algoritmen føre til høyere overheadkostnader ved kontekstbytte, ettersom systemet må bytte mellom prosesser oftere. For å overvinne disse begrensningene har det blitt utviklet varianter av algoritmen, for eksempel Weighted Round Robin-algoritmen.

Round Robin Scheduling er en mye brukt planleggingsalgoritme som sikrer rettferdig og effektiv allokering av ressurser i operativsystemer, nettverkssystemer og nettskybaserte databehandlingsmiljøer. Selv om den har noen begrensninger, er den fortsatt et populært valg for mange applikasjoner på grunn av sin enkelhet og effektivitet.

nb_NONorwegian